Grave Yard

Graveyard

What is recorded here

The graveyard in Macreary is in County Tipperary, Ireland. It occupied a roughly rectangular unenclosed area in the flat Ivowen valley, with a north-south stream flowing fifty metres to the east. The church stood along the north boundary towards the west end. Neither the church nor the graveyard is visible at ground level today, though a thirty-eight by forty-five metre area remains untilled where the church stood.
In flat terrain with a stream running N-S 50m to the E, in Ivowen valley, under tillage. A graveyard is indicated on the 1st (1840) ed. OS 6-inch map as roughly rectangular area delineated by a dashed line, suggesting it was unenclosed. The church (TS079-014----), which is no longer visible, was located along the N boundary of the graveyard towards the W end. Neither the church or graveyard are visible at ground level, however, an area (dims. 38m x 45m) occupied by the former church has been left untilled, though it is not fenced off.
